Weekly Sugary Drinks Boost Oral Cancer Risk Fivefold

  • Women who frequently indulge in sugar-sweetened beverages are facing alarming risks, according to a recent study in JAMA Otolaryngology. Those who drink these sugary drinks weekly have nearly five times the risk of developing oral cavity cancer, with non-smokers and non-drinkers at an even greater risk. Experts urge cutting back on these drinks to protect health.
